PRESIDENT Hakainde Hichilema says his government has used the first 100 days in office to understand where the leakages are coming from and to realign the system. And President Hichilema has made several new government appointments, notable among them; Permanent Secretary Special Duties Cabinet Office Patrick Mucheleka, Disaster Management and Mitigation Unit (DMMU) National Coordinator Dr Gabriel Pollen, Permanent Secretary Ministry of Defence Norman Chipakupaku, Permanent Secretary Local Government and Rural Development (Administration) Mambo Hamaundu, among others. Meanwhile, President Hichilema has terminated the services of the Civil Service Commission, the Teaching Service Commission, the Zambia Correctional Service Commission, the Zambia Police Service Commission and the Local Government Service Commission.
